)]}'
{
  "commit": "cddf391bf6839e9f093cef15508669c1f3f92122",
  "tree": "38dfaa5a7b98776ba67bb8a812beec8724810839",
  "parents": [
    "5a616c08ce089e25dc0e8da920727af4d11279bf"
  ],
  "author": {
    "name": "G.Balaji",
    "email": "balajig81@gmail.com",
    "time": "Sat Nov 26 21:59:32 2011 +0400"
  },
  "committer": {
    "name": "Denis Ovsienko",
    "email": "infrastation@yandex.ru",
    "time": "Mon Jan 23 14:30:42 2012 +0400"
  },
  "message": "zebra: IPv4 MP-BGP Routes addition and deletion\n\nThis patch contains the following:\n1. Addition of IPv4 SAFI_MULTICAST BGP routes into the RTM\u0027s RIB.\n2. Deletion of IPv4 SAFI_MULTICAST BGP routes from the RTM\u0027s RIB.\n",
  "tree_diff": [
    {
      "type": "modify",
      "old_id": "95399fa16ebf8968136c9622464be6536a051221",
      "old_mode": 33188,
      "old_path": "zebra/connected.c",
      "new_id": "8db2d3679acceff2061c3876075754a4c7e082b5",
      "new_mode": 33188,
      "new_path": "zebra/connected.c"
    },
    {
      "type": "modify",
      "old_id": "e7ceea54f3061136e7ec86c72ee55b18c4e1e517",
      "old_mode": 33188,
      "old_path": "zebra/kernel_socket.c",
      "new_id": "1ad2a811ec8c1ec4afa319dceb1458688c7349e7",
      "new_mode": 33188,
      "new_path": "zebra/kernel_socket.c"
    },
    {
      "type": "modify",
      "old_id": "20a206eae8601868380475a6864dde169b374452",
      "old_mode": 33188,
      "old_path": "zebra/rib.h",
      "new_id": "27a2de699399b87146187985d2ea14e8d48dc398",
      "new_mode": 33188,
      "new_path": "zebra/rib.h"
    },
    {
      "type": "modify",
      "old_id": "a09e459c3819b79ac8f9ed49ea2e929a45f7462a",
      "old_mode": 33188,
      "old_path": "zebra/rt_netlink.c",
      "new_id": "8e1285db36837e7264c50bfa50f5a6c9b71abd8a",
      "new_mode": 33188,
      "new_path": "zebra/rt_netlink.c"
    },
    {
      "type": "modify",
      "old_id": "3e065c6f4ff6ea51fb0c97bd283f38ebfde8e8e0",
      "old_mode": 33188,
      "old_path": "zebra/rtread_getmsg.c",
      "new_id": "81bf0de6478a7caaa01a341acd5975cb5ac74f34",
      "new_mode": 33188,
      "new_path": "zebra/rtread_getmsg.c"
    },
    {
      "type": "modify",
      "old_id": "1de435a494255fa757d5bb6aeb3532c7e2dce394",
      "old_mode": 33188,
      "old_path": "zebra/rtread_proc.c",
      "new_id": "07e8491adf640d165cc26e6f47ad1c4940bd6cb5",
      "new_mode": 33188,
      "new_path": "zebra/rtread_proc.c"
    },
    {
      "type": "modify",
      "old_id": "d239501d33ef6b6c6a286053dec9f2a124d1dd22",
      "old_mode": 33188,
      "old_path": "zebra/zebra_rib.c",
      "new_id": "a366cf1fa2423a6ff018a61cf88631d5105dd576",
      "new_mode": 33188,
      "new_path": "zebra/zebra_rib.c"
    },
    {
      "type": "modify",
      "old_id": "05485a134500f1cc407dd874fa82aee2d507fc78",
      "old_mode": 33188,
      "old_path": "zebra/zebra_vty.c",
      "new_id": "1785fec0a622d650dba5a7abf59c4cf2da6da7ff",
      "new_mode": 33188,
      "new_path": "zebra/zebra_vty.c"
    },
    {
      "type": "modify",
      "old_id": "ec8cbf2b2a9c08a8cf65e034a429385263de2af8",
      "old_mode": 33188,
      "old_path": "zebra/zserv.c",
      "new_id": "310c6ce652799400c116fc6916173584ef1c10c1",
      "new_mode": 33188,
      "new_path": "zebra/zserv.c"
    }
  ]
}
